About this House

This single-family home is located at 2520 16th St, Bakersfield, CA. 2520 16th St is in the Riviera - Westchester neighborhood in Bakersfield, CA and in ZIP code 93301. This property has 3 bedrooms, 1 bathroom and approximately 1,077 sqft of floor space. This property has a lot size of 6098 sqft and was built in 1947.
2520 16th St, Bakersfield, CA 93301 is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,077 sqft single-family home in Riviera - Westchester, built in 1947. It last sold for $69,500 on Feb 22, 2001.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$267,500, with a rent estimate of $1,774/month.
